The cost of living in Kigali is 57% less expensive than in Prague. Cities ranked 6835th and 2821st ($758 vs $1778) in the list of the most expensive cities in the world and ranked 1st and 2nd in Rwanda and the Czech Republic, respectively. Check Rwanda vs the Czech Republic comparison.

The average after-tax salary is enough to cover living expenses for 0.3 months in Kigali compared to 1.3 months in Prague. Kigali ranked 1st best city to live in Rwanda vs Prague ranked 1st in the Czech Republic, while ranked 6733rd and 277th among best cities to live in the world.
